Finding Pokémon Cards in Stock: Your Local Guide
Locating available Pokémon cards can be a genuine challenge! Several regional retailers, like Target, frequently run out of inventory quickly. Start by scouting their digital storefronts for updated information on new arrivals. Alternatively, consider calling personally to the particular businesses; employees often have reliable insight into upcoming restock dates. Don't dismiss smaller, boutique hobby shops – they might have secret gems and present a better experience!
